Lawmakers fight to strip Cosby of medal
WASHINGTON • A bipartisan group of United States lawmakers was set to introduce legislation on Friday that provides President Barack Obama authority to revoke the Presidential Medal of Freedom granted to actor Bill Cosby, who has admitted to drugging women.

Hospital demolished with staff still inside
BEIJING • Workers partially demolished a Chinese hospital in Henan province with several doctors and a patient still inside, burying bodies in its morgue under rubble, the media reported yesterday.
A probe has been launched.

No asylum for criminal refugees
MAINZ • Migrants who commit crimes should lose their right to asylum, German Chancellor Angela Merkel said yesterday, toughening her tone as crowds protested in Cologne after mass assaults on women, allegedly by refugees, on New Year's Eve.
